Safety Management Systems
Safety remains the foundation of every successful aviation operation.
A structured Safety Management System (SMS) helps organizations identify potential risks before they become operational issues.
Key elements include:
- Risk assessment
- Hazard reporting
- Internal audits
- Safety monitoring
- Incident analysis
- Continuous improvement
An effective safety culture benefits employees, passengers, and aircraft owners alike.
Aircraft Acquisition and Technical Evaluation
Purchasing an aircraft requires detailed technical analysis.
Professional aviation experts evaluate:
- Aircraft condition
- Maintenance history
- Airworthiness status
- Technical documentation
- Component life
- Operational suitability
Independent evaluations help buyers make informed investment decisions.

Importance of Technical Documentation
Accurate documentation supports safe aircraft operations.
Essential records include:
- Aircraft logbooks
- Maintenance records
- Airworthiness certificates
- Inspection reports
- Component histories
- Operational manuals
Well-maintained documentation improves transparency and regulatory readiness.
